Shell Takes Over Azeri Gas Volumes From Engie

Royal Dutch Shell has increased its uptake of gas from Phase 2 of the BP- operated Shah Deniz project by sign- ing an agreement with Engie to take over part of the French energy group’s 25-year contract with Azerbaijan Gas Supply Co. (AGSC). Shell and Engie, formerly Gaz de France, were two of nine companies that signed long-term contracts with AGSC — which represents the Shah Deniz consortium — in September 2013, accounting for the full 10 Bcm/ yr of Phase 2 gas that will flow to Europe. The other seven buyers are Axpo Trading, Bulgargaz, Depa, Enel, E.On, Hera Trading and Gas Natural. Under a deal struck last year, Gas Natural agreed to transfer all of its en- titlement to Italy’s Edison.
